Abstract

While there is increasing evidence for antiferromagnetic (AF) ordering in the Cu-O planes of high-[Formula presented] superconductors, either static or fluctuating, there is no direct evidence so far for the charge stripes that should separate the AF domains. By investigating the optical response of [Formula presented] for [Formula presented] and [Formula presented], we identify strong far infrared peaks whose energy, width, and intensity are consistent with a scenario of charge stripe dynamics in the Cu-O planes.
